High-End Vapes For Less? Ghost Cart Scam Alert!

Wanna get your hands on some elite Platinum vapes without blowing your bankroll? Think twice before you bite at those shady deals on so-called Black Market carts. They might seem like an easy way to score some serious money, but you could end up with a lemon.

These fake carts are being peddled as the real deal, but they're often filled with cut products. That means there's a chance you might get sick from inhaling something dangerous.

Don't take the gamble your health for a bargain vape. Stick to trusted sources and do your research. Your lungs will thank you!

Are Ghost Carts Real or Hype?

The vape scene is always buzzing with new gizmos, and lately, there’s been a lot of talk about "ghost carts." These mysterious containers are said to be packed with potent concentrates, but are they really all they’re hyped up to be? Some say ghost carts are the real deal, offering a powerful experience. Others claim they're just another marketing ploy, filled with who-knows-what.

The situation is murky. There’s no easy way to verify the contents of a ghost cart, and that makes them incredibly unpredictable. You could be getting what you paid for, or something far more harmful.

  • ,Here’s the bottom line Ghost carts are a gamble. If you’re looking for a safe vaping product, it's best to stick to known products from legitimate sources.
